ฉันจะเรียงลำดับตัวเลขใน Linux ได้อย่างไร

หากต้องการเรียงลำดับตามหมายเลข ให้เลือกตัวเลือก -n เพื่อ sort การดำเนินการนี้จะเรียงลำดับจากจำนวนต่ำสุดไปยังจำนวนสูงสุด และเขียนผลลัพธ์ไปยังเอาต์พุตมาตรฐาน สมมติว่ามีไฟล์ที่มีรายการเสื้อผ้าที่มีตัวเลขอยู่ที่ต้นบรรทัดและจำเป็นต้องจัดเรียงเป็นตัวเลข

ฉันจะเรียงลำดับในคำสั่ง Linux ได้อย่างไร

Unix Sort Command พร้อมตัวอย่าง

  1. sort -b: ละเว้นช่องว่างที่จุดเริ่มต้นของบรรทัด
  2. sort -r: ย้อนกลับลำดับการเรียงลำดับ
  3. sort -o: ระบุไฟล์เอาต์พุต
  4. sort -n: ใช้ค่าตัวเลขเพื่อจัดเรียง
  5. sort -M: เรียงตามเดือนปฏิทินที่ระบุ
  6. sort -u: ระงับบรรทัดที่ทำซ้ำคีย์ก่อนหน้า

18 พ.ค. 2021 ก.

ฉันจะเรียงลำดับตัวเลขใน Linux จากมากไปหาน้อยได้อย่างไร

-r Option: Sorting In Reverse Order : คุณสามารถทำการเรียงลำดับแบบย้อนกลับได้โดยใช้แฟล็ก -r แฟล็ก -r เป็นตัวเลือกของคำสั่ง sort ซึ่งเรียงลำดับไฟล์อินพุตในลำดับย้อนกลับ เช่น ลำดับจากมากไปน้อยโดยค่าเริ่มต้น ตัวอย่าง: ไฟล์อินพุตเหมือนกับที่กล่าวไว้ข้างต้น

ฉันจะจัดเรียงคอลัมน์ตามไฟล์ใน Linux ได้อย่างไร

การเรียงลำดับตามคอลัมน์เดียวต้องใช้ตัวเลือก -k คุณต้องระบุคอลัมน์เริ่มต้นและคอลัมน์สิ้นสุดเพื่อจัดเรียงตาม เมื่อจัดเรียงตามคอลัมน์เดียว ตัวเลขเหล่านี้จะเหมือนกัน ต่อไปนี้คือตัวอย่างการจัดเรียงไฟล์ CSV (คั่นด้วยเครื่องหมายจุลภาค) ตามคอลัมน์ที่สอง

การเรียงลำดับของ Linux ทำงานอย่างไร

ในการคำนวณ sort คือโปรแกรมบรรทัดคำสั่งมาตรฐานของระบบปฏิบัติการ Unix และ Unix ที่พิมพ์บรรทัดของอินพุตหรือการต่อไฟล์ทั้งหมดที่อยู่ในรายการอาร์กิวเมนต์ตามลำดับการจัดเรียง การเรียงลำดับทำได้โดยใช้คีย์การเรียงลำดับตั้งแต่หนึ่งคีย์ขึ้นไปที่แยกจากแต่ละบรรทัดของอินพุต

ฉันจะจัดเรียงไฟล์ตามชื่อใน Linux ได้อย่างไร

หากคุณเพิ่มตัวเลือก -X ls จะจัดเรียงไฟล์ตามชื่อภายในแต่ละหมวดหมู่ส่วนขยาย ตัวอย่างเช่น จะแสดงรายการไฟล์ที่ไม่มีนามสกุลก่อน (ตามลำดับตัวอักษรและตัวเลข) ตามด้วยไฟล์ที่มีนามสกุล เช่น . 1, . bz2, .

ฉันจะจัดเรียงไฟล์ได้อย่างไร

มุมมองไอคอน หากต้องการจัดเรียงไฟล์ในลำดับอื่น ให้คลิกปุ่มตัวเลือกมุมมองในแถบเครื่องมือแล้วเลือกตามชื่อ ตามขนาด ตามประเภท ตามวันที่แก้ไข หรือตามวันที่เข้าถึง ตัวอย่างเช่น หากคุณเลือก By Name ไฟล์จะถูกจัดเรียงตามชื่อตามลำดับตัวอักษร ดูวิธีการจัดเรียงไฟล์สำหรับตัวเลือกอื่นๆ

คำสั่งใดใช้เรียงลำดับตัวเลขจากน้อยไปมาก

คำสั่ง Linux 50+ อันดับแรก

คำสั่งการเรียงลำดับของ Linux ใช้สำหรับจัดเรียงเนื้อหาไฟล์ในลำดับเฉพาะ รองรับการจัดเรียงไฟล์ตามตัวอักษร (จากน้อยไปมากหรือมากไปหาน้อย) ตัวเลข ในลำดับย้อนกลับ ฯลฯ

คุณเรียงลำดับอย่างไรในลำดับที่กลับกัน?

เรียงลำดับจากมากไปน้อย

การตั้งค่าย้อนกลับ = True จะเรียงลำดับรายการจากมากไปหาน้อย อีกวิธีหนึ่งสำหรับ sorted() คุณสามารถใช้รหัสต่อไปนี้

คำสั่งใดมีวิธีจัดเรียงหลายระดับ

เมื่อคุณเรียงลำดับข้อมูลโดยใช้กล่องโต้ตอบการเรียงลำดับ คุณจะได้รับตัวเลือกในการเพิ่มหลายระดับลงไป
...
การเรียงลำดับหลายระดับโดยใช้กล่องโต้ตอบ

  1. เรียงตาม (คอลัมน์): ภูมิภาค (นี่คือการเรียงลำดับระดับแรก)
  2. เรียงตาม: ค่า
  3. ลำดับ: A ถึง Z
  4. หากข้อมูลของคุณมีส่วนหัว ให้ตรวจสอบว่าได้เลือกตัวเลือก "ข้อมูลของฉันมีส่วนหัว" แล้ว

ฉันจะจัดเรียงไฟล์หลายไฟล์ใน Linux ได้อย่างไร

การจัดเรียงไฟล์เป็นตัวเลข

ใช้ตัวเลือก -n เมื่อคุณต้องการให้แน่ใจว่าบรรทัดถูกจัดเรียงตามลำดับตัวเลข ตัวเลือก -n ยังช่วยให้คุณจัดเรียงเนื้อหาไฟล์ตามวันที่ได้ หากบรรทัดในไฟล์เริ่มต้นด้วยวันที่ในรูปแบบ “2020-11-03” หรือ “2020/11/03” (รูปแบบปี เดือน วัน)

ใครสั่งใน Linux?

คำสั่ง Unix มาตรฐานที่แสดงรายชื่อผู้ใช้ที่เข้าสู่ระบบคอมพิวเตอร์ในปัจจุบัน คำสั่ง who เกี่ยวข้องกับคำสั่ง w ซึ่งให้ข้อมูลเหมือนกัน แต่ยังแสดงข้อมูลและสถิติเพิ่มเติมด้วย

ฉันจะเรียงลำดับในคำสั่ง awk ได้อย่างไร

ก่อนที่คุณจะเรียงลำดับได้ คุณต้องสามารถโฟกัส awk เฉพาะฟิลด์แรกของแต่ละบรรทัดได้ นั่นคือขั้นตอนแรก ไวยากรณ์ของคำสั่ง awk ในเทอร์มินัลคือ awk ตามด้วยตัวเลือกที่เกี่ยวข้อง ตามด้วยคำสั่ง awk ของคุณและลงท้ายด้วยไฟล์ข้อมูลที่คุณต้องการประมวลผล

Uniq ทำอะไรใน Linux?

คำสั่ง uniq ใน Linux เป็นยูทิลิตี้บรรทัดคำสั่งที่รายงานหรือกรองบรรทัดที่ซ้ำกันในไฟล์ พูดง่ายๆ ก็คือ uniq เป็นเครื่องมือที่ช่วยตรวจหาบรรทัดที่ซ้ำกันที่อยู่ติดกันและลบบรรทัดที่ซ้ำกันด้วย

ฉันจะจัดเรียงไฟล์บันทึกใน Linux ได้อย่างไร

หากคุณต้องการเรียงลำดับบรรทัดตามลำดับเวลา คุณจะต้องละตัวเลือกนี้ ตัวเลือก –key=1,2 บอกให้ sort ใช้เฉพาะ "ฟิลด์" ที่คั่นด้วยช่องว่างสองช่องแรก ("freeswitch. log:" - วันที่นำหน้าและเวลา) เป็นคีย์สำหรับการเรียงลำดับ

AWK ทำอะไรกับ Linux?

Awk เป็นโปรแกรมอรรถประโยชน์ที่ช่วยให้โปรแกรมเมอร์สามารถเขียนโปรแกรมขนาดเล็กแต่มีประสิทธิภาพในรูปแบบของคำสั่งที่กำหนดรูปแบบข้อความที่จะค้นหาในแต่ละบรรทัดของเอกสารและการดำเนินการที่จะดำเนินการเมื่อพบการจับคู่ภายใน ไลน์. Awk ส่วนใหญ่จะใช้สำหรับการสแกนและประมวลผลรูปแบบ

ชอบโพสต์นี้? กรุณาแบ่งปันให้เพื่อนของคุณ:
ระบบปฏิบัติการวันนี้